TABLE 2.
Quantitation of virus releasea
| Virus | Approx. no. of cells infected (108) | Total U of NP harvested | U of NP harvested/106 cells | Fold decrease in U/cell relative to that for wt |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| rSV5 | 2.4 | 4,254 | 17.7 | 1.0 |
| rSV5 HNΔ2-9 | 6.4 | 1,564 | 2.4 | 7.3 |
| rSV5 HNΔ2-13 | 6.4 | 971 | 1.5 | 11.7 |
wt rSV5, rSV5 HNΔ2-9, and rSV5 HNΔ2-13 were grown in MDBK cells, and at 7 days p.i. the culture media were harvested and virions were purified by centrifugation through two sequential sucrose gradients. Thirty-six equal fractions were taken from the top of each gradient, and fractions 13 to 36 were assayed for NP protein by quantitative dot blotting. The total amount of NP protein harvested (arbitrary units [U]) was calculated by summing the amounts of NP protein detected in the gradient fractions.
